## Onboarding: Fareweight Rules Engine

Fareweight computes shipping fees from stacked rule sets. Rules are versioned; never edit a live version. Deploys go through the staging evaluator first. Read the rule DSL guide before touching anything.

Rule definitions live in the pricing database — connect to it with the connection string below.

primary connection of yagep-bajop = postgresql://druiel_svc:gW@db-3860.sivrelworks.example:5432/brieth

## Account Recovery — Trailnote Offline Mode

When a surveyor's Trailnote app has been offline for 30+ days, their local credentials expire and sync refuses to resume. Don't make them wipe the device — all their unsynced field data lives there! Instead, open the support console, pick "Offline Reinstate," and enter their handle. The console will ask for the support team's shared recovery passphrase before issuing a reinstatement token. Use the one below.

unlock words, bagaf-fajeg: zorael-kelax-fraath-quenix-eliok-sileth-aldmir-wenir-druiel

## Onboarding: Parcelflow Webhook Receiver

The Parcelflow receiver accepts delivery-status callbacks from the Swiftroute courier network. Each inbound request carries an HMAC signature computed over the raw body; the receiver verifies this before any parsing occurs, and unsigned or mismatched payloads are rejected with a 401 and logged to the audit stream. Verification requires the shared signing secret, which is read from the environment at startup and never written to disk or logs. In the service's env file, it appears on the following line.

secret setting of yajog-taguf: ARCHIVE_KEY3=051

# Search relevance tuning notes — Quillfish release prep
# Heads up: we bumped the synonym boost from 1.2 to 1.4 after the Larkmoor
# test run, so expect recall to creep up a bit. Don't touch the decay curve
# settings until Priya's follow-up experiment wraps. If ranking looks weird
# in staging, it's probably the stale index, not these values. Rebuild first,
# panic second. The reranker service also needs its credential here before
# anything will boot. The line below sets it.

sealed setting: ARCHIVE_KEY3=8d0